A vulnerability was found in Campcodes Complete Web-Based School Management System 1.0. It has been declared as critical.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own functionality of the file /view/student_first_payment.php. The manipulation of the argument grade leads to sql injection.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ier VDB-265093 was assigned to this vulnerability.
